The White Cliffs of Dover is a 1944 American war drama film based on the verse novel The White Cliffs by Alice Duer Miller.It was made by Metro-Goldwyn-Mayer, directed by Clarence Brown, and produced by Clarence Brown and Sidney Franklin.The screenplay was by Claudine West, Jan Lustig [] and George Froeschel, with the credit for additional poetry by Robert Nathan. "(There'll Be Bluebirds Over) The White Cliffs of Dover" is a popular World War II song composed in 1941 by Walter Kent to lyrics by Nat Burton. The cliffs are white because they are mostly chalk with bits of flint mixed in.
